    Default Remove XP class bias - equalize XP gain per action?

    When I made a new monk, I was desperate to at least level my STR and DEX just a little bit, so I could use the basic implants and some decent armor and such. (I wanted to use the Metalplated vest, not Spirit Armor, since I was mainly fighting aggressors). What made sense to me was to use melee attacks - that's surely STR/DEX right - just for one or two levels. I went in the sewer and started punching spiders. I had discovered that I was getting zero EXP (across the board - all skills - zero exp) for killing dozens of spiders, even though I was still low enough level to receive the full credit reward for the kills, and I thought it was a bug, and made a bug report thread on it.

    One of the replies to the thread said that they did indeed gain some EXP for using their fists and stiletto, so I went and tried again. I still received literally 0 EXP for most kills, but, some of the slightly higher enemies, like Poisonous Fierce Spider, gave me a miniscule amount of EXP - something around 11 EXP for killing 10 of them.

    I did an experiment just now and these were the results:

    • On a low-level tank with 13 STR
    • Using a TL-10 Tsurugaoka sword
    • Which deals 7 damage per hit to aggressor captains

    For killing 5 Aggressor Captains (completely alone) I received:
    1. 2265 STR xp
    2. 710 DEX xp



    .. and then, switching characters ..

    • On a mid-level monk with 19 STR
    • Using a TL-17 rusty double-edged sword
    • Which deals 12 damage per hit to aggressor captains

    For killing 5 Aggressor Captains (completely alone) I received:
    1. 212 STR xp
    2. 206 DEX xp


    .. to verify, I switched weapons ..

    • On the same monk with 19 STR
    • Using a TL-29 unlabeled electro shocker
    • Which deals 14 damage per hit to aggressor captains

    For killing 5 Aggressor Captains (completely alone) I received:
    1. 206 STR xp
    2. 197 DEX xp


    The issue is I am getting an impossibly low amount of XP on a character who has more STR and DEX than the other one, using a better weapon than the other one, and even doing twice the damage per hit.

    So I feel if a Monk, PE, or Spy casts a spell on a mob, dealing 30 damage, every class should get the exact same amount of PSI exp. The same should apply for using H-C weapons (any class), melee, pistols, rifles, and all tradeskills too. If a tank wants to level his INT by researching, he should be able to, and he should get the exact same exp that a spy would get for doing the same TL research.

    In chat the other day I saw someone say something like, "I'm a spy, and I'm using H-C weapons to level my str, but I'm not getting any str exp. but that should work in theory.. right?" I don't think that guy was dumb for trying that. It's sensible to believe that it should work, since every skill is available to every class.

    What I mean is, why does the game allow a spy to spec H-C, if he doesn't get any (or terribly small) exp for using the H-C skill?

    If it were equalized, this may solve a few problems like spies not being able to level STR and monks being nearly forced to level DEX by repairing rhinos?
